ABOUT Welcome to our tapas and markets tour in Barcelona! We will begin our tour at the iconic Palau de la Música, located in the heart of the city.
From here, we will head to the famous Mercado de la Boquería, one of the most emblematic markets in Barcelona. Here we can see and taste a great variety of fresh products, including seafood, cold cuts, fruits, and typical sweets from the region.
After touring the Mercado de la Boqueria, we will venture into the charming Gothic Quarter, one of the oldest and most picturesque neighborhoods in the city. Here we can enjoy its narrow streets, arches, and squares full of history.
We will continue our tour to the Plaza Sant Jaume, where the historic buildings of the City Hall and the Government of Catalonia are located. Finally, we will head to the famous Mercado de Santa Caterina, located in the heart of the lively born neighborhood.
At the Mercado de Santa Caterina, we will discover a wide variety of local products, from fresh fish to seasonal fruits and vegetables. Here we will also have the opportunity to taste some of the best tapas in the city, prepared with fresh and high-quality ingredients.
Throughout the tour, our expert guide will tell us stories and anecdotes about Catalan culinary culture and give us tips on the best places to eat in the city.

Mercado de la Boquería dates back to the 13th century and has evolved into one of Europe’s most important food markets.
Many vendors at La Boquería emphasize sustainably sourced and locally produced ingredients, supporting regional farmers and fisheries.
